view3dscene 4.0.0.view3dscene by Michalis Kamburelis

May 19, �� you will find views about View3Dscene yet. Be the very first! Comment. Much like View3Dscene. SketchUp Pro. Effortless, fast 3D modeling tool. Blender. Excellent 3D Modeling program. ZModeler. One of the best 3D modeling tools. Meshroom. Make models that are 3D photos. Rhino. Simple to discover and use 3D design program. Jun 04, �� view3dscene is a viewer for all 3D and 2D model formats supported by Castle Game motor. view3dscene is a viewer for many 3D and 2D model formats supported by Castle Game Engine. glTF; X3D; VRML; Sprite sheets in Starling and Cocos2d platforms; Spine JSON animations (from Spine or 5/5.

View3dscene.View3dscene: App Reviews, Features, Pricing & Download | AlternativeTo

Jul 14, �� view3dscene-mobile Mobile-friendly viewer for 3D models like X3D, VRML, glTF, Collada, Wavefront OBJ, Spine JSON and other platforms supported by the Castle Game Engine. Besides the above formats, additionally allows to start a ZIP file that contains a single model and associated media (like textures, sounds etc.). view3dscene is a VRML / X3D browser, also a viewer for other 3D models. Supported platforms are X3D, VRML ( and (aka VRML 97)), Collada, 3DS, MD3, Wavefront OBJ scenes. Can do collision detection. May be used as command-line converter from Collada, 3DS, OBJ, MD3 to VRML/X3D. Has ray-tracer that is built-in. Rendering uses OpenGL. Free software. May 19, �� There are opinions about View3Dscene yet. Be the first! Comment. Similar to View3Dscene. SketchUp Pro. Easy, fast 3D modeling tool. Blender. Excellent 3D Modeling program. ZModeler. One of the best 3D modeling tools. Meshroom. Make models that are 3D photos. Rhino. Easy to learn and use 3D design program.

Development log
View3Dscene for Windows – Down Load
1. Downloading and setting up
Download view3dscene

Explore the world that is virtual collisions, gravity, animations, sensors, shadows, mirrors, shaders and much more. It is possible to transform all models to X3D. Download additionally our collection of demo models to try view3dscene! No installation is needed. Just install and unpack these archives wherever you would like, and run the view3dscene program inside.

Included can also be the tovrmlx3d program, ideal for transforming 3D models to X3D in batch command-line mode. Designers can install sources of this program.

Demo scenes : our demo models contains a complete lot of interesting models, you can open them all with view3dscene. For Windows: All useful libraries are already included in the archive, which means you don’t need to do just about anything. Mac OS X requirements are listed here. Different navigation modes can be found: Examine easily turn and move the model that is whole Walk walk like in FPS games, with collision detection, gravity and relevant features available , Fly similar to Walk but without gravity.

All model formats may be converted to X3D. You can also use view3dscene as a “pretty-printer”, simply available and save your self any X3D or VRML file without any variation conversion. Command-line options to convert in batch mode –write are available in view3dscene. Special minimized binary tovrmlx3d useful to install on servers without GUI libraries available can also be a part of view3dscene archive.

Built-in ray-tracer that is also available as a command-line that is separate, rayhunter to generate nice views of the scene with shadows, mirrors, and transmittance. There are also very limited editing capabilities. They are intended to be used only as post-processing of some model. We intentionally do not try to implement a full 3D authoring program here. You’ll activate VRML pointing-device sensors by clicking with remaining mouse key the cursor can change form and you will get status information whenever your cursor has ended some clickable sensor.

Observe that this ongoing works only when Collision detection is on as it requires octree. There are menu items and command-line options to catch screenshots and films of 3D scenes and animations. We can also make a special “screenshot” of 3D environment as a cube map to DDS, or six separate images. When the cursor turns into a grabbing hand you know you can click or drag on this 3D object.

It is usually comfortable to combine it with movement utilizing AWSD secrets. There are numerous more operations with key shortcuts, that work in every navigation modes. Simply explore the view3dscene menu, and appearance at the shortcuts that are key. All options described below might be offered in every purchase. All are optional. They learn about animations kept in 3D files, that’s why they take parameters explaining the animation time to capture. They’ve been used to simply take screenshots in “batch mode”.

For a scene that is still 3D you usually just want to use the simpler –screenshot option with TIME set to anything like zero and not worry about anything else. For animations , more possibilities are available. You can capture any frames of the animation by using many options that are–screenshot. The advantage that is biggest of recording film in this way is the fact that movie is guaranteed to be captured with stable wide range of frames per second.

This is diverse from using some separate programs to recapture OpenGL output, like the fine GLC nice GLC overview here , as real-time capture usually means that the program runs slower, and often you loose movie quality. You most definitely want to pass 3D model file to load at command-line too, otherwise we’ll just make a screenshot of the default empty scene that is black.

Therefore to simply take a screenshot that is simple of scene, at it’s default camera, just call. The detailed specification how screenshot options work : First of most, after all of the –screenshot and –screenshot-range options are processed, view3dscene exits. So they really work in “batch mode”. Option of each one of these video platforms may depend on installed ffmpeg codecs. Information about using filename habits are below it works : although you can probably already guess how.

All filenames for both screenshot options may specify a pattern in the place of an filename that is actual. For –screenshot-range with an image pattern, we do this for every single frame. The countertop begins at 1. For instance, countertop 1 results in names like 1, 2, add option that is–screenshot-transparent have a transparent image, with clear pixels in position where background color will be visible.

For example, have a look at this sample VRML file. You can make use of command-line that is–viewpoint see below to choose a different viewpoint for screenshot. To control the size of resulting screenshot, just use –geometry command-line parameter documented at standard options comprehended by our OpenGL programs. To help make your screenshot look best, you may want to use anti-aliasing, see –anti-alias option below.

To simply take a screenshot on a stripped-down Unix host , please keep in mind you will need to install a environment that is graphic is, X Windows and OpenGL on your server. Even in batch mode, we still use OpenGL to grab the screenshot images because using off-screen Mesa or our toy ray-tracer doesn’t result in a really nice output; we really want OpenGL for anyone GLSL effects and such. Ordinarily, you also require GTK libraries installed.

Nonetheless, you can compile from sources a form of view3dscene it doesn’t require these libraries, and straight accesses XWindows. It’ll miss a menu club plus some other good GUI stuff, but that isn’t a challenge if you only want to run it in batch mode for screenshots. There are basically two solutions to this:. You can keep the X server running continuously, and keep your user logged in to the X server, and instruct view3dscene to connect to your X that is running host. Unfortuitously, this method sometimes fails.

The view3dscene will get an OpenGL context without a FrameBuffer long story short, it means that you cannot capture the screen without actually seeing the window and the resulting screenshot will be pure black or garbage on some systems. On other systems, there is a problem with glXChooseVisual that may hang until you actually switch the terminal that is current the X server.

The other approach, more reliable in my experience please share your experience that is own on forum is to create new X server along with running view3dscene, by using xinit. The important thing is to specify the full path of the view3dscene binary otherwise xinit only adds the arguments to some default xterm command-line that is useless. Adding — :1 at the end is only necessary if the default display :0 may be already taken. Most formats glTF 2. In this case, view3dscene is just a “pretty-printer”, precisely preserving all the information in the file, only reformatting your content and getting rid of the reviews.

VRML 2. Conversion from VRML 2. Changing encoding is a operation that is lossless as the exact same nodes graph may be precisely expressed both in encodings. Every one of these conversions could be also done in batch mode by command-line options described below.

You can either utilize view3dscene with –write choice, or you may use split binary tovrmlx3d. Separate tovrmlx3d may be sometimes more desirable, as it’s smaller, not linked with any GUI libraries so it will work even on a system that is stripped-down has easier command-line choices as it’s function is to convert.

Other –write-xxx choices affect the generated output. By default, we use classic encoding. Force output to be an X3D file. This is really useful only when input model is VRML 2. When this is used on VRML 1. Real conversion from VRML 1. This option is meaningful only when option that is–write also used. See docs that are–write-force-x3d.

Other choices –hide-menu Hide the top menubar. Useful for full-screen presentations. Using this command-line option is mainly useful together with –screenshot option. Exact 0 means “no anti-aliasing”, this is the default. Each integer that is successive makes technique one step better.

But also more � that is demanding may run slower if your graphic card cannot provide context with sufficient number of samples needed for multi-sampling. Currently, highest value is 4. From your user standpoint, you can look at each technique and just decide which looks best and is not too slow in your 3D model and visual card. Specifies the true title or several of the standpoint which will be bound utilized if the scene is packed. Or you can just exchange the order of standpoint nodes.

But sometimes it isn’t comfortable to modify the scene. Particularly if you want to utilize the –screenshot options to capture a scene, it’s beneficial to have the ability to choose a viewpoint by this command-line option.

As usual all standard options understood by OpenGL programs , standard choices understood by OpenAL 3D sound programs , standard choices understood by all my programs are also permitted.

Run with command-line –help to get full list. Deprecated options –scene-change-no-normals –scene-change-no-solid-objects –scene-change-no-convex-faces Using one of these options changes the scene if you used –write option before it is displayed or saved to X3D or VRML.

These options are of help whenever you suspect that some of the informations in scene file are incorrect. These options change only the scene which filename was specified at command-line. Later on scenes which you start making use of “Open” menu product aren’t afflicted with these options.

Instead, you need to use “Edit” menu commands to do any of these scene modifications at any time.

Promising Russian task “Android-socket”sixteen.08.2021 [12:08],
Pavel Kotov

The idea of “smart house” is normally connected with one thing large-scale, highly complicated, smart and prohibitively expensive, although using the desire and appropriate technical training, some functions associated with “smart house” are today that is available. Moreover, these functions do not require any out-of-the-box solutions that are technological. This is certainly plainly demonstrated by the project that is domesticAndroid os Rosette”.

Mcdougal associated with the project is the St. Petersburg engineer Kirill Sizyukhin, as you might guess from the name, the device he developed is an electronic patch that connects to a regular outlet and is controlled using an Android smartphone on which the corresponding application is installed. The connection between the smartphone and the socket is carried out via Bluetooth. The device operates on the basis of a CSR BC417143B microcontroller with a Bluetooth firmware and module made to receive commands from a smartphone. The “Android socket” also includes a bistable relay with a high switching current (220V, 16A), a transistor switch for managing the relay winding and a pulse power.

The writer individually developed an Android application for a smartphone, with its assist the socket is controlled by the user. When connecting for the first time, the consumer switches the outlet to the detection mode and links to it from a smartphone. It will take from 2 to 4 seconds, plus the commands are executed directly straight away. If desired, an individual can create a team of outlets into the application and give them commands during the same time, it is also possible to regulate one outlet from several smart phones.

An function that is important also feedback, the user gives a command to the “Android outlet” and can track the status of its execution, as well as the availability of the outlet, because for objective reasons the connection can suddenly be cut off and the device will be out of the reach. There is also a timer function for both on and off. It should be noted that the power that is maximum of connected devices cannot exceed 3 kW, the writer indicates that probably the most “gluttonous” consumers, for example, kettles and heaters, have an electric of 2 kW. The device needs associated with smartphone app are simple, Google Android OS version 2 or higher must certanly be installed.2. As time goes by, it’s also prepared to develop a customer applet for the Windows mobile platform.

Kirill Sizyukhin posted information about the Android os Sockets project regarding the Crowdfunding Portal “Through the World”, this will be a domestic analogue of Kickstarter. To launch a project, the author needs to collect investments in the amount of 90 thousand. rubles, the expense of pre-ordering one device is 900 rubles., whenever buying several copies, the cost is paid down to 850 rubles.

Related materials:

a supply:

Leave a Reply

Your email address will not be published. Required fields are marked *